forwardcabin Posted June 18, 2015 #6 Share Posted June 18, 2015 ...but was thinking I needed a piece of paper or something along with IDS etc to get on the cruise. ......Under Manage > My Booking > Cruise Details, in the To Do List, click View Cruise Documents. We usually print all the docs that are displayed there like the Boarding Pass, Luggage Tags, and General Information. Attach the luggage tags to the luggage. We usually also attached one to each carry on as well. Along with your passports, present the Boarding Pass at the beginning of the embarkation process. You will also need to complete the Public Health Questionnaire and present it at check-in when you get your S&S cards. Keep all the other printed documents with you for the duration of the cruise.
